Spanish exchange shareholders back flotation

Shareholders in Bolsas y Mercados Españoles have agreed to sell the minimum percentage of stock required for the company's proposed flotation to proceed.

The exchange shareholders, who had until Monday to tender their stock, agreed to sell a 33.07% stake in BME, paving the way for an initial public offering later this year.
